Not quite satisfied with killing it on the sales charts, Royal Enfield has created an entire ecosystem around its customers, selling them not only bikes, but also well-designed apparel, riding gear and accessories. Last year, the brand introduced the ‘Make-It-Yours’ configurator that allows you to customise your bike before making a booking, and this service was recently extended to RE’s t-shirts and helmets as well. Via the Make-It-Yours initiative, buyers can tinker with the appearance of their t-shirts and helmets, choosing from a range of colour options and graphics schemes to tailor their own personal look.

Now, thanks to an interaction with Puneet Sood, Head of Royal Enfield's Apparel Business, we know that the next step along the way is to allow buyers to customise their riding gear, starting with the excellent range of riding jackets that Royal Enfield offers. Protecting you is only half the job, a riding jacket also needs to make you look badass, so buyers will be able to tinker with the style and colour schemes before making a purchase. By the end of it, hopefully you too will be grinning like Jehan in the picture above. With time, the customisation programme will also be extended to RE’s other protective gear like riding pants and gloves.
